Clash of Titans: AL Central Leaders Face Red-Hot Red Sox

White Sox Eye First-Half Finish Strong After Cleveland Series

Following a hard-fought four-game split in Cleveland, the Chicago White Sox are returning to their home turf with a clear objective: to cement their position atop the AL Central division as the first half of the season draws to a close. Their recent performance, including two crucial wins against the Guardians, signals a team determined to maintain its lead.

Red Sox Momentum: A Force to Be Reckoned With

The Boston Red Sox arrive in Chicago riding a wave of success, fresh off a three-game sweep against the Los Angeles Angels. Their impressive 8-2 record over the last ten games, which includes a dominant sweep over the Yankees, has propelled them to within striking distance of a wild-card spot, making them a formidable opponent for the White Sox.

Noah Schultz: The Young Arm on the Mound

Left-handed pitcher Noah Schultz is slated to make his tenth career start for the White Sox, and his second since returning from the injured list. Despite a season ERA of 5.86 and a WHIP of 1.349, his FIP of 4.86 suggests some unluckiness. His powerful fastball, averaging over 95 mph, has proven effective, holding opponents to a low batting average of .156, even as he works to refine his control and walk rate.

Boston's Strategic Lineup Against Schultz

The Red Sox are expected to counter Schultz with a right-handed heavy lineup, featuring power hitters like Ceddanne Rafaela and Willson Contreras, both of whom boast impressive batting averages and OPS numbers. This strategic approach aims to exploit any vulnerabilities in the young pitcher's game, setting the stage for a challenging matchup.

White Sox Offensive Strategy Against Payton Tolle

The White Sox offense will face southpaw Payton Tolle, who has been a consistent performer for the Red Sox with a 3.39 ERA and 1.117 WHIP over 74 1/3 innings. Given their strong team OPS of .748 against left-handed pitching and their ability to hit home runs in these matchups, the White Sox are adjusting their lineup with more right-handed batters to maximize their offensive potential. Notable adjustments include Miguel Vargas leading off and Randal Grichuk as the designated hitter.
